He said investigators have already tracked down one Camrose teen who had illegally posted the names of the four accused minors online and forced him to remove them.
In the New World Order of the Citizen Journalist, it's an interesting question as to whether or not a Joe Schmo putting the names on a website is actually doing something illegal, or could be held to the standard of a professional news organization.
Certainly, a real-life journalist doing that in a newspaper or on a legitimite news website would be cooked by the judge for doing it . . . . . but does that or should that test actually apply to the public at large offering the same utterances?
